I was informed that STLink works with other vendors parts (on the openocd list). Not tried it myself.

J-link is already processor-agnostic, it is not tied to a particular manufacturer.

There seems to be a new emerging standard CMSIS-DAP, I think it works a bit like ST-Link but is non-proprietary. That is, a microcontroller on the debug pod acts as a bridge between USB and SWI/JTAG, handling the low level details with lower latency than USB can manage.
